StackScope is a free public catalogue of indie launches. We find launches on Product Hunt, Hacker News and similar feeds, then crawl each site to detect its tech stack and score it for launch readiness: DNS, security headers, SEO basics. This page is what we saw on 16 July 2026; the live site may have changed since.

OffPay is largely in shape, with complete legal pages and a complete set of security headers. What needs work: no robots.txt or sitemap and no email security records.

Launched on PeerPush on July 16, 2026. The site is hosted on Vercel, with a domain registered 4 weeks before launch. The crawl picked up 5 technologies on this site, covering DNS providers, web fonts, hosting, and security. The stack includes Google Fonts, HSTS, and Spaceship DNS.
